Mitogen-Activated Protein Kinase 8
**Semantic type:** Amino Acid, Peptide, or Protein|Enzyme
**Definition:** Mitogen-activated protein kinase 8 (427 aa, ~48 kDa) is encoded by the human MAPK8 gene. This protein plays a role in serine/threonine phosphorylation, apoptosis and toll-like receptor signaling.
**Synonyms:** - EC 2.7.11.24 - JN Kinase - JNK1 Protein - MAP Kinase 8 - MAPK 8 - MAPK8 - SAPK/JNK - SAPK1 - SAPK1/JNK - SAPK1c - Stress-Activated Protein Kinase 1 - Stress-Activated Protein Kinase 1c - Stress-Activated Protein Kinase JNK1 - c-JUN N-Terminal Kinase
